These protective containers are typically constructed from durable materials like high-impact plastic or reinforced polymers, designed to safeguard firearms from damage during transport, storage, or handling. They often feature specialized compartments for the firearm itself, as well as for accessories such as ammunition, magazines, cleaning supplies, and other related equipment. Some models also incorporate locking mechanisms to restrict access and enhance security. A typical example might be a hard-sided case with custom-cut foam inserts to cradle a specific pistol or rifle.

Proper firearm storage and transportation contribute significantly to responsible gun ownership. These containers offer protection against accidental impacts, moisture, dust, and unauthorized access, preserving the firearm’s condition and functionality. Historically, protective cases for firearms have evolved from simple wooden chests and leather satchels to the highly engineered protective solutions available today. This evolution reflects an increasing emphasis on security, durability, and portability.

1. Protection

Protection represents a primary function of a firearm storage case. Damage prevention during transport, handling, and storage constitutes a significant aspect of responsible firearm ownership. These cases mitigate risks associated with accidental impacts, environmental factors such as moisture and dust, and potential corrosion. A rifle stored in a quality case within a humid climate, for example, experiences significantly less risk of rust compared to a rifle stored unprotected. This preservation of the firearm’s condition ensures its functionality, reliability, and longevity.

The protective qualities stem from the materials used in construction and the case’s design features. Durable polymers, reinforced corners, and custom-fit foam inserts contribute to impact resistance. Water-resistant seals and airtight closures provide a barrier against moisture and dust. The structural integrity of the case safeguards against crushing forces. A case dropped accidentally, for instance, provides a protective buffer against potential damage to the firearm within, compared to an unprotected firearm experiencing the same impact.

Question 1: Are these cases compliant with airline regulations for transporting firearms?

Airline regulations regarding firearm transport vary. While these cases often feature robust locking mechanisms, confirming compliance with specific airline policies before travel is crucial. Consulting the airline’s official guidelines ensures adherence to their specific requirements.

Question 2: What types of firearms are suitable for storage in these cases?

Various sizes and configurations accommodate a range of firearms, from pistols and revolvers to rifles and shotguns. Selecting the appropriate case size and internal configuration ensures a proper fit and optimal protection for the specific firearm being stored.

Question 3: How do these cases contribute to preventing accidental discharges?

Secure storage within a dedicated case significantly reduces the risk of accidental discharges. The case’s protective features prevent accidental impacts or jarring that could cause a discharge. Further, secure locking mechanisms restrict access, preventing unauthorized handling and potential accidental discharges by individuals unfamiliar with firearm safety protocols.

Question 4: Are these cases waterproof or only water-resistant?

While many cases offer water resistance, providing protection against splashes or light rain, they are not typically fully waterproof. Submerging the case is not advisable. Specifications regarding the case’s water resistance level should be confirmed with the manufacturer to understand its limitations. Additional protective measures, such as waterproof bags or desiccants, might be necessary in extreme conditions.

Question 5: What maintenance procedures are recommended for these cases?

Regular maintenance ensures the case’s longevity and effectiveness. Cleaning the exterior with a damp cloth removes dirt and grime. Inspecting locking mechanisms and hinges for proper function and lubricating them periodically maintains smooth operation. Avoiding har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ners preserves the case’s finish and structural integrity.

Question 6: Can these cases be used for long-term firearm storage?

These cases are suitable for both short-term transport and long-term storage. However, for extended periods, ensuring the storage environment remains cool, dry, and stable is essential. Using desiccants within the case can help mitigate moisture buildup, especially in humid climates. Regularly inspecting the firearm for any signs of corrosion or damage remains a crucial practice, even during long-term storage.

Tips for Utilizing Protective Firearm Cases

Appropriate use of protective firearm cases ensures firearm safety and longevity, contributing significantly to responsible gun ownership. The following tips offer guidance on maximizing the benefits of these essential storage solutions.

Tip 1: Select the Correct Size: Cases should correspond precisely to the firearm’s dimensions. An overly large case allows excessive movement during transport, potentially causing damage. Conversely, an overly tight fit can scratch the firearm’s finish or impede proper closure.

Tip 2: Utilize Proper Locking Mechanisms: Always engage locking mechanisms when storing or transporting firearms. This prevents unauthorized access and deters theft, contributing to responsible gun ownership practices. Consider TSA-approved locks for air travel, ensuring compliance with regulations.

Tip 3: Employ Interior Protection: Foam inserts within the case cradle the firearm, preventing movement and absorbing shocks during transport. Periodically inspect foam for wear and tear, replacing it if necessary to maintain optimal protection.

Tip 4: Store Ammunition Separately: Ammunition should be stored in a separate, locked container, even when utilizing a locked firearm case. This precaution enhances safety and complies with many regulations regarding firearm transport and storage.

Tip 5: Consider Environmental Factors: Extreme temperatures or humidity can impact a firearm’s condition. Using desiccants within the case helps control humidity, mitigating potential corrosion. Avoid leaving cases in direct sunlight or extreme cold.

Tip 6: Inspect Regularly: Regularly examine the case for signs of wear and tear, such as cracks, damaged hinges, or faulty locks. Addressing these issues promptly ensures the case continues providing adequate protection and security.

Tip 7: Understand Applicable Regulations: Familiarize oneself with local, state, and federal regulations regarding firearm transport and storage. Adhering to these regulations ensures legal compliance and promotes responsible gun ownership practices.
